Subject: Undo/redo cut-over done

Hey — quick summary for on-call. We switched Sketchloom's undo/redo from the old snapshot stack to the new command-log service tonight. Rollback path still exists until Friday, so don't panic if you see dual writes in the logs. If anything looks off, check the history service first. Current production settings are below.

config for badup-kagap:
OLIOX_PIN=5344
OLIOX_METRICS_HOST=metrics.oliox.zemvarcorp.corp
OLIOX_LOG_LEVEL=error
OLIOX_TENANT=pelox

## Canary Gating Configuration

Flarepath gates canary promotion on three rules: error rate under 0.5% for ten minutes, p99 latency within 1.2x baseline, and no open sev-1 incidents in Pagemill. If any rule fails, rollback is automatic — do not override without a second on-call ack. The gate evaluator must authenticate to the metrics bridge, so place its token on the following line.

sealed setting: ARCHIVE_KEY3=8d0

Finance Review — Concentration Risk

Branch managers: Orvath Logistics now accounts for 41% of receivables, up from 28% last year. One account. Any delay in their payments strains our cycle. Actions: cap new Orvath credit at current levels, push diversification targets to each branch, and report pipeline weekly to the Fennley desk. No exceptions without finance sign-off. This is a risk item, not a growth story. The related confidential note appears directly below.

management briefing: Only 34 of the 227 pilot accounts renewed Julath, so a churn review is set for December 28. Jorwynox Foods is in early talks to buy Silirix Freight for about $241.8 million.